DocumentCode :
1514604
Title :
Compiler-assisted synthesis of algorithm-based checking in multiprocessors
Author :
Balasubramanian, Vijay ; Banerjee, Prithviraj
Author_Institution :
Dept. of Electr. Eng., Illinois Univ., IL, USA
Volume :
39
Issue :
4
fYear :
1990
fDate :
4/1/1990 12:00:00 AM
Firstpage :
436
Lastpage :
446
Abstract :
The task of synthesizing algorithm-based checking techniques for general applications is investigated. The problem is approached at the compiler level by identifying linear transformations in Fortran DO loops and restructuring program statements to convert nonlinear transformations to linear ones. System-level checks based on this property are proposed. The approach is demonstrated with example problems of matrix multiplication and the LINPACK routine: DGEFA
Keywords :
concurrency control; fault tolerant computing; multiprocessing systems; DGEFA; Fortran DO loops; LINPACK routine; algorithm-based checking; compiler assisted synthesis; linear transformations; matrix multiplication; multiprocessors; nonlinear transformations; Costs; Encoding; Fast Fourier transforms; Fault detection; Hypercubes; Matrix converters; Matrix decomposition; Message passing; Parallel processing; Program processors;
fLanguage :
English
Journal_Title :
Computers, IEEE Transactions on
Publisher :
ieee
ISSN :
0018-9340
Type :
jour
DOI :
10.1109/12.54837
Filename :
54837
Link To Document :
بازگشت